centripetal
Adjective

centripetal (not comparable)

  1. Directed or moving towards a centre.
  2. Of, relating to, or operated by centripetal force.
  3. (neuroanatomy, of a nerve impulse) Directed towards the central nervous system; afferent.
Pronunciation
  • IPA: /sɛnˈtɹɪpətəl/, /ˌsɛntɹəˈpiːtəl/
